Baltimore Orioles first baseman-designated hitter Aubrey Huff is scheduled to undergo sports hernia surgery Friday that will prevent him from participating in baseball-related activities for six weeks, a club spokesman told the Baltimore Sun.
Huff should be ready about the time the Orioles' position players have their first spring training workout Feb. 19 in Fort Lauderdale, Fla.
Club officials said they knew that Huff had felt discomfort in his groin during offseason workouts but hoped he would be able to avoid the surgery, which will be performed by Dr. William Meyers in Philadelphia. Huff could miss a few days of camp.
